18 Now the birth of Je­sus Christ was on this wise: When as his moth­er Mary was es­poused to Joseph, be­fore they came to­geth­er, she was found with child of the Holy Ghost. 19 Then Joseph her hus­band, be­ing a just man, and not will­ing to make her a pub­lick ex­am­ple, was mind­ed to put her away priv­i­ly. 20 But while he thought on these things, be­hold, the an­gel of the Lord ap­peared unto him in a dream, say­ing, Joseph, thou son of David, fear not to take unto thee Mary thy wife: for that which is con­ceived in her is of the Holy Ghost.
